- 14:55:22 [Zakim]
- agendum 9. "new optional-filter test" taken up [from LeeF]
- 14:56:02 [LeeF]
- -> http://lists.w3.org/Archives/Public/public-rdf-dawg/2007OctDec/0003.html contains Chimezie's proposted new test
- 14:56:39 [chimezie]
- I wrote that while trying to figure out why: LeftJoin(Ω1, Ω2, expr) = Filter(expr, Join(Ω1, Ω2)) set-union Diff(Ω1, Ω2, expr)
- 14:56:43 [chimezie]
- isnt' equivalent to :
- 14:56:51 [chimezie]
- LeftJoin(Ω1, Ω2, expr) = Filter(expr, Join(Ω1, Ω2)) set-union Ω1
- 14:58:20 [AndyS]
- ARQ passes the test
- 14:58:42 [chimezie]
- ericP: does top-down / bottom-up evaluation effect this?
